"This post includes affiliate links for which I may make a small commission at no extra cost to you should you make a purchase."

Close up iPhone showing Udemy application and laptop with notebook


Sqoop, an open-source tool from Apache, has revolutionized the way data is transferred between Apache Hadoop and structured datastores, like Relational Database Management Systems (RDBMS). It enables users to efficiently import data from external systems into Hadoop and export data from Hadoop into external systems. With the rapidly increasing demand for Big Data professionals, acquiring the necessary skills in Sqoop can give you a competitive edge in the job market. In this article, we will explore the 10 best Sqoop courses and certifications available online, providing you a well-rounded understanding and expertise in this powerful tool.

1. Coursera – Apache Sqoop: Big Data Integration

Coursera brings you an excellent Sqoop course designed by Cloudera, a leading provider of Apache Hadoop-based software and services. This comprehensive course covers everything, from Sqoop’s architecture and data ingestion techniques to advanced topics like tuning Sqoop performance. With a combination of video lectures, quizzes, and hands-on exercises, you will gain practical experience in transferring data from RDBMS to Hadoop using Sqoop. Upon successful completion, you will receive a shareable Coursera certificate.

2. Udemy – Apache Sqoop with Flume and Hive

If you want to explore the full potential of Sqoop along with other Hadoop ecosystem tools like Flume and Hive, this Udemy course is a great choice. With over 4 hours of video content, you will learn how to import data not only from RDBMS but also from various sources using Apache Flume. The course also delves into integrating Sqoop with Hive, enabling advanced analytics on imported data. At the end of the course, you will receive a certificate of completion.

3. edX – Introduction to Apache Sqoop

edX offers a self-paced introductory course on Apache Sqoop developed by Cloudera. With a focus on hands-on exercises, you will learn how to use Sqoop to import data into Hadoop and export it back to RDBMS. Additionally, you will understand Sqoop’s integration capabilities with various sources like MySQL, Oracle, and DB2. This course is ideal for beginners who want to get started with Sqoop. Upon completion, you will receive an edX certificate.

4. Big Data University – Data Integration with Apache Sqoop

Big Data University provides a free online course that covers all the essentials of Sqoop. With a step-by-step approach, you will acquire how to import data into Hadoop, manage incremental data imports, and optimize Sqoop’s performance. The course also includes quizzes and hands-on labs to assess your understanding. On successful completion, you will receive a badge to showcase your accomplishment.

5. LinkedIn Learning – Apache Sqoop: Getting Started

LinkedIn Learning’s Sqoop course serves as a beginner’s guide to data transfer using Sqoop. It covers the basics of Sqoop, including its architecture, command-line tool, and various data transfer scenarios. By the end of the course, you will be able to import and export data between Hadoop and external systems effortlessly. A certificate of completion is awarded upon finishing the course.

6. Simplilearn – Big Data Hadoop and Spark Developer Certification Training

Simplilearn’s comprehensive Big Data Hadoop and Spark Developer Certification Training includes a dedicated module on Sqoop. This course focuses on imparting extensive knowledge about Sqoop’s architecture, integration with Hadoop, data transfer techniques, and performance tuning. The program also provides hands-on lab exercises and real-life projects to sharpen your skills. After completing the course and passing the final exam, you will receive a Certification of Achievement from Simplilearn.

7. Pluralsight – SQL Server and Hadoop: Importing and Exporting Data

Pluralsight offers a specialized course that explores the integration between SQL Server and Hadoop, with a primary focus on Sqoop. This course provides detailed guidance on utilizing Sqoop to transfer data between SQL Server and Hadoop, along with best practices for optimal performance. The course includes practical exercises and demonstrations to enhance your understanding. As a Pluralsight subscriber, you will have unlimited access to this course.

8. DataFlair – Apache Sqoop Tutorial

DataFlair’s Apache Sqoop Tutorial is a beginner-friendly, step-by-step guide for learning Sqoop from scratch. The course covers all aspects of Sqoop, starting from installation and configuration to advanced topics like exporting data to RDBMS. With an emphasis on practical implementation, this course ensures you gain hands-on experience on real-life datasets. A certificate of completion is provided at the end of the course.

9. Intellipaat – Big Data Hadoop Certification Training

Intellipaat’s Big Data Hadoop Certification Training is a comprehensive program that covers a wide range of Big Data tools and technologies, including Sqoop. Through instructor-led training, you will learn Sqoop’s fundamentals, data ingestion techniques, and parallel data ingestion. Additionally, hands-on exercises and projects will solidify your understanding. On completion, you will receive a globally recognized certificate, boosting your career prospects.

10. YouTube Tutorials

YouTube hosts an extensive collection of Sqoop tutorials created by experts in the field. These tutorials provide step-by-step guidance on various aspects of Sqoop, including installation, configuration, and data transfer scenarios. While not offering a formal certification, YouTube tutorials are a valuable resource for self-paced learning and can be useful for brushing up on specific Sqoop topics.


Acquiring certification in Sqoop not only enhances your skill set but also increases your market value in the rapidly growing field of Big Data. The online courses mentioned above provide you with comprehensive training, covering various aspects of Sqoop’s data integration capabilities. Whether you are a beginner or an experienced professional, these courses offer a range of learning options to suit your requirements. Invest in one of these courses today and harness the power of Sqoop to excel in your Big Data career.